Transaction f4169343c7115795d1d851f1f1fe96cc38ae68a51a74c9dadea6da1904ecf59c
2 Input
2 Outputs
- f4169343c7115795d1d851f1f1fe96cc38ae68a51a74c9dadea6da1904ecf59c:0
- f4169343c7115795d1d851f1f1fe96cc38ae68a51a74c9dadea6da1904ecf59c:1
value 119023
address 33WXHs4XE9AvNb6WMAfNaPY4C6K4HN6h9e
value 9636
address 16DvfytB4nTsUCBBmo5d1BUNRWAdyoMX9i